Visually, the ๐ฎ๐จ emoji features a vertical tricolor design. It consists of three equally sized stripes: white on the hoist (left) side, a striking blue in the center, and a cheerful yellow on the fly (right) side. Centered on the blue stripe is the coat of arms of the Canary Islands, which includes two Canarian dog breeds (Podenco Canario) supporting a shield with seven islands, a crown, and a motto. The white often symbolizes the snow-capped peak of Teide in Tenerife, the blue represents the vast Atlantic Ocean surrounding the islands, and the yellow evokes the sun and sandy beaches. It's a colorful and distinctive representation that immediately identifies this special region.
